Are you interested in being connected by Bluetooth with your period?

We told you about the menstrual cup, many women are now turning to it, tired of the problems of irritation and allergies caused by sanitary napkins and tampons.

This time it's a menstrual cup called Looncup, which has just appeared on the crowdfunding platform Kickstarter (it has already raised nearly €40,000), the Looncup allows women to track their menstrual cycles.

The novelty:the Looncup is connected, it comes with a mobile application and its Apple Watch version, which tells you when the cup is full (“Oh I have to go to the toilet »; when the next period will arrive and analyzes the menstrual cycle. By analyzing the color of the blood, she would be able to tell if there is a health problem, such as the appearance of a cyst. This information is sent to your smartphone using Bluetooth.

If it seduces the followers of "you have to live with the times “, others have reservations about such a device in its intimacy.

Indeed, the cup contains a battery, a sensor and an antenna at the end of the cup which allows connectivity. The idea of ​​monitoring stress, cholesterol levels, lack of sleep is great, but let's admit that such a device will make sterilization complicated...

Anyway, the Looncup should be launched in January 2016, even if the creators assure that there is no risk on health one wonders about the dangerousness of the waves.
